*May 6, 2008, Monday, My son, Jan (Yahn), went into the Navy
*June 27, 2008, Friday - (PIR, Pass In Review) Boot Camp Graduation in IL!! Hooray! He was with DIV 235, Ship 07
*July 20, 2008, Sunday - Jan was accepted into the Ceremonial Guard and will be leaving for DC on July 23, 2008 - just 2 days before his birthday!
*July 27, 2008, Sunday - Jan is now in DC and his CG training has already started.
*Sept. 16, 2008: Jan passed his first inspection (UT's) for the Ceremonial Guards
*Sept. 28, 2008: Jan passed UT's, A's, B's and Gate Standing. He is now getting ready for the Full Dress Inspection.
*October 2, 2008 - He passed Full Dress Inspection! YaY! All that is left is Lockers and then to Drill Out.
October 22, 2008 - Jan passed Lockers Inspection. Hooray!
November 8, 2008 (+ Nov. 17)- Drilled out.
November 21, 2008 - Ceremonial Guard Boot Camp graduation. YaY!
